About this Property
Occupying a perfectly private position in the quiet cul de sac end of Macmillan Street behind a high sandstone-footed fence and automated gates, this gorgeous family home exudes classic appeal and timeless style. Beautifully combining both charm and elegance, the home is positioned well back from the street to take full advantage of its ideal northerly aspect and capture both refreshing sea breezes and leafy vistas from its slightly elevated setting. Natural materials thoughtfully employed throughout complement the original curved sandstone façade and footings, enhancing the home's enduring appeal and creating a warm organic aesthetic that feels both timeless and inviting.
- Elegant light-soaked living/dining with vaulted ceiling, gas fireplace and wall-to-wall glass sliding doors opening to curved north-facing entertaining terrace with elevated leafy views and ocean cameos
- Deluxe entertainers' kitchen with granite benchtops/breakfast bar, premium Falcon freestanding oven with gas cooktop and opening out onto rear deck
- Private fully-enclosed backyard with new hardwood entertaining deck, built-in bbq and pizza oven plus lock-up garden shed
- Bright, airy master bedroom opening out onto north-facing terrace, walk-thru robe and luxe ensuite with exquisite Pink Patagonia Quartzite feature wall and vanity top
- Versatile bedroom or study/office with built-in storage and glass doors opening to rear deck and backyard
- Spectacular family bathroom with Pink Patagonia Quartzite feature wall and vanity top, freestanding bathtub and separate shower
- Generous second living room downstairs with stunning sandstone feature wall
- Two bedrooms downstairs, both with built-in robes – one oversized with expansive curved wall with multiple windows; shared shower bathroom
- Study with custom built-in shelving and glass doors opening directly onto sunny terrace
- Plantation shutters, brushbox floorboards, cast iron balustrades and original internal sandstone feature walls
- Sweeping north-facing garden with gas-heated saltwater pool framed by timber decking and adjacent level lawn plus beautifully incorporated sandstone retaining walls and landscaped gardens
- Lock-up garage with gated driveway parking for multiple vehicles plus substantial under-house lock-up storage
